Centralized Real Estate Accelerator

Description

We launched The Accelerator in 2020 to accelerate, scale and sustain a community-based real estate development system in Pittsburgh.

Goal of Program

The program’s goal is to ensure that community developers can forge long-term outcomes designed to benefit all residents. Excited to get started? Here is a tool to help you realize your Design and Development Priorities and help prepare to engage with a design team! 

What We Provide

Through this program we provide technical assistance, capacity building, and connections with experienced real-estate professionals who can assist with strategy, coordination, mentorship and coaching. The Accelerator focuses on community-based organizations, resident developers, and small business owners with the goal of creating more opportunities for community ownership in Black and Brown communities, as well as a pipeline of investable projects.
